Output de59eb6a0819f41ed92394b67dc1292b57236ad11ea214d6d15918724a738b1b:1

value
10685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dba185821602d552470a4132683648dd6f64bb3 OP_EQUAL
address
3QpbpC1pHnSKsD26mYNEvJUsp5iqCcCUFf
transaction
de59eb6a0819f41ed92394b67dc1292b57236ad11ea214d6d15918724a738b1b
spent
true